Output 66e5078cb37283b08b21f764a1fbd5e52e4566d60959e5bba7dd9ffb137abecf:1
- value
- 18607856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a2cbc8d120946e3ba6658904de8a7317d726085 OP_EQUAL
- address
- 3EHcmN7NbKToTgCNQ5LuPRMVQjhq9CaYoE
- transaction
- 66e5078cb37283b08b21f764a1fbd5e52e4566d60959e5bba7dd9ffb137abecf
- confirmations
- 305122
- spent
- true